ARE you looking for new and inventive ways to slash your food bill each month?

A money-saving mum has come up with her own set of rules that she says are super easy to follow – and have shaved off a whopping £300 from her groceries every four weeks. 

TikTok user Nicole Mcshane, who can be found at @mrsnicolemcshane, told her followers that her batch cooking and other budgeting ways also meant she only had to do a big shop once every six weeks. 

She said: “Let me share with you how we have saved around £300 a month by batch cooking.”

The video then showed Nicole making a list of all of the family’s lunches and dinners for the week, including family favourites like tacos, fajitas, spaghetti bolognese and chilli. 

She continued: “So today is prep day – I’m making a list of all the meals we’re going to make, and all the ingredients we’re going to need.”

Nicole then said that her family have swapped trips to the supermarkets for a mooch around their local market, and she’s seen the difference straight away.

She went on to say: “We had off to the market. The market is more sustainable, better quality food and a lot cheaper than the supermarket. 

“We get everything we need for the next six weeks’ worth of lunches and dinners cost us around £62, which is amazing.” 

She later revealed that another top tip she’s learnt over the years is to always have the same meals so that she knows the ingredients back to front.

But perhaps the most impressive thing about Nicole’s money-saving is that the family still enjoys weekend takeaways.

Nicole wrote: “Yes we have the same meals each week and we have takeaways/treats at the weekend. 

“We still spend the same on our treats, just our grocery bill is a lot less.”
